Man Rapes friend's Mentally Challenged Daughter; Held - Vellore

A 50 year-old man was arrested on Wednesday for raping his friend’s 35 year-old mentally challenged daughter.

The shocking incident came to light when the mother of the victim took her daughter to the Primary Health Centre (PHC) in Alamelumangapuram as her daughter was vomiting frequently. She was told at the PHC that her daughter was pregnant. This prognosis was confirmed at the  Government Vellore Medical College Hospital (GVMCH) on Tuesday. The doctor at the GVMCH, after examining the victim, told the mother that the victim was three months pregnant.

“My daughter started to vomit frequently a week ago. Worried about her health, the mother first took her to a PHC in Alamelumangapuram for treatment. The doctors, after finding that she was pregnant, referred her to the GVMCH for further check up,” said the police personnel attached to the All Women Police Station (AWPS) of Ranipet.

On being informed, Inspector J Kalaiarasi of AWPS, Ranipet, learned from the mother that her daughter had told her that Vetri Selvan (alias) Hidayathullah their close family friend and a resident of Melvishram, had been ‘physically intimate’ with her. “The victim’s mother often goes to her brother’s house in Oosur and stays there for a week. Her father goes to work and returns home late. Taking advantage of this, Hidayathuallah threatened the mentally challenged woman, who was also partially disabled, and raped her,” police said.


Based on the complaint lodged by the victim’s mother, the police registered a case under Section 376 (rape) and Section 506(i) (criminal intimidation) of the IPC and arrested Hidayathullah on Wednesday. He has been remanded under judicial custody in the Vellore Central Prison.
